Many communities in Appalachia have been disproportionately impacted by economic and technological change.

The pace of change is occurring exponentially faster than it did just five years ago, requiring students and their communities to learn the skills and capabilities to contribute and compete in a rapidly changing environment.

The Wing 2 Wing Foundation supports charitable efforts that prioritize accessible education to prepare the next generation with the skills and capabilities necessary to succeed in a fast moving, increasingly digital world.

Working to increase access to educational opportunities for West Virginians is critical to our future success as we prepare our youth for the challenges of the 21st Century.

$25M

donation made in 2018 to the Marshall University Lewis College of Business will help provide new and dynamic opportunities for current and future business students.

250+

public-school teachers received critical class room donations to expand STEM learning opportunities.

200

scholarships offering first-in-their-family college students a chance to attend Marshall University and The Ohio State University.
